What is a Tacoma Rear Differential & Why It Matters
The rear differential on your Toyota Tacoma is a sophisticated assembly of gears that serves a fundamental purpose: allowing the rear wheels to spin at different speeds. This is crucial when your truck turns, as the outside wheel must travel a greater distance than the inside wheel. Without this differential action, your truck would experience tire scrubbing, drivetrain binding, and poor handling, especially during turns. For a Tacoma, which often sees varied terrain from daily driving to off-road adventures, a properly functioning rear differential is paramount for both performance and component longevity. At its core, the differential is a mechanical marvel that splits engine torque between two drive wheels. In a standard open differential, this split is dynamic; if one wheel loses traction, it can spin freely, sending minimal power to the wheel that *does* have grip. This is a common scenario for many trucks, but for those seeking enhanced off-road prowess or towing stability, more specialized differentials exist, such as limited-slip (LSD) or locking differentials. Each type offers distinct advantages depending on your driving needs.
Core Components and Their Roles
The main components within a rear differential housing include the ring gear, pinion gear, spider gears (or planet gears), and side gears. The pinion gear, driven by the driveshaft, meshes with the larger ring gear, which then turns the differential carrier. Inside the carrier, the spider gears pivot and rotate, allowing the side gears (connected to the axle shafts) to spin at different rates. This intricate gear work is housed within a robust casing, often featuring a differential cover, like the Dana 35 differential cover found on some older vehicles, which protects the gears and holds the lubricating fluid.
This mechanism is critical for enabling smooth, controlled power delivery to the wheels, especially under dynamic conditions. Understanding this principle is fundamental to appreciating why differential maintenance is not an option but a necessity.
This entire system relies on precise gear meshing and adequate lubrication. Any wear or contamination can quickly lead to significant issues.
Common Rear Differential Issues and Maintenance Best Practices
What happens when the rear differential starts to fail? The most common indicators are audible cues. You might hear whining, humming, or clunking noises that change with speed or acceleration. These sounds often signal gear wear or insufficient lubrication. Leaks from the differential housing, particularly around the pinion seal or axle seals, are another clear sign that fluid levels are dropping, increasing the risk of internal damage. Grinding noises when turning can point to compromised spider gears or a failing limited-slip clutch pack.
Ignoring these symptoms can escalate minor problems into costly repairs. Essential Differential Service Steps
Regular differential service is your best defense. The primary consideration involves changing the differential fluid at recommended intervals, typically every 30,000 to 60,000 miles, depending on driving conditions. For severe use like towing, off-roading, or frequent water crossings, this interval should be shorter. The process involves:
- Safely lifting the vehicle and placing it on jack stands.
- Locating and removing the differential drain plug (if equipped) and fill plug.
- Draining the old fluid completely.
- Reinstalling the drain plug.
- Refilling the housing with the correct type and amount of gear oil specified in your owner's manual. It's imperative to acknowledge the specific viscosity and additive requirements for your Tacoma.
- Reinstalling the fill plug.
Inspect the drained fluid for metal shavings; excessive amounts indicate internal wear that requires immediate attention from a specialist.
Beyond fluid changes, periodically inspect the differential housing for signs of damage or leaks. Check the breather vent to ensure it's not clogged, which can cause pressure buildup and lead to seal leaks. Choosing the Right Differential for Your Tacoma's Needs
While most Tacomas come equipped with an open rear differential from the factory, understanding alternative options can significantly enhance your truck's capabilities. The choice largely depends on your intended use. An open differential is economical and smooth for everyday driving and light off-roading but can leave you stranded if one wheel loses traction. For those who frequently venture off-pavement or tow heavy loads, an upgrade becomes highly beneficial.
Upgrade Paths: LSD vs. Locking Differentials
A Limited-Slip Differential (LSD) is a popular upgrade. It uses a clutch pack or gears to automatically distribute torque between the wheels, sending some power to the wheel with better traction when slippage occurs. This provides a significant improvement in off-road traction and on-road stability without the drawbacks of a full locker. A true Locking Differential (or locker) is the ultimate off-road traction enhancer. When engaged, it forces both rear wheels to rotate at the exact same speed, regardless of traction. This guarantees maximum power delivery to both wheels, even in extreme conditions. However, lockers must be disengaged on pavement to prevent drivetrain binding and damage. Comparing Differential Options
| Feature | Open Differential | Limited-Slip Differential (LSD) | Locking Differential |
|---|---|---|---|
| Traction in Slippery Conditions | Poor (wheel spins freely) | Good (sends some power to the other wheel) | Excellent (forces both wheels to turn together) |
| On-Road Manners | Smooth, quiet | Slightly more noticeable under load | Requires disengagement on pavement, can bind |
| Complexity & Cost | Simplest, lowest cost | Moderate complexity and cost | Most complex, highest cost (especially selectable) |
| Off-Road Capability | Basic | Significantly improved | Maximum capability |
Our analysis indicates that for most Tacoma owners seeking a balance of daily drivability and enhanced off-road performance, an LSD offers the most practical upgrade. If extreme off-roading is your primary pursuit, a selectable locker is the superior choice, provided you understand its operational limitations.
